Detailed Comparison
Performance
The DOKIO 100W panel provides a solid output for charging 12V batteries, making it ideal for caravans, RVs, and boats. With monocrystalline technology, it's efficient with sunlight conversion, but its lower wattage limits power generation in cloudy conditions. The BLUETTI 120W panel slightly edges ahead with its higher power output, making it suitable for larger portable power stations. It features adjustable kickstands for optimal sunlight capture, enhancing its performance during varying daylight conditions. Thus, in terms of performance, the BLUETTI is the winner.
Build Quality and Design
DOKIO's foldable solar panel is lightweight and easy to transport, making it a favorite for mobile users. However, its build quality may feel less robust compared to the BLUETTI. The BLUETTI solar panel is designed with durability in mind, featuring a sturdier frame and premium materials intended for frequent outdoor use. The adjustable kickstands also give it an edge in usability, allowing users to set it up in various terrains. Therefore, the BLUETTI wins in build quality and design.
Battery Life
Both panels are designed for efficient battery charging; however, the DOKIO's 100W output limits the speed of charging larger batteries. The BLUETTI, with its 120W capability, not only charges faster but is also compatible with a wider range of power stations, enhancing versatility. In this category, the BLUETTI takes the lead again.
Price and Value for Money
The DOKIO solar panel kit is priced at £79.99, which represents a great entry-level option for those who are budget-conscious. In contrast, the BLUETTI solar panel is priced at £288.56, which may deter some buyers. However, considering its higher efficiency and capabilities, the value for money becomes more apparent for users who need more power. For those on a tight budget, DOKIO clearly wins here, but the value perspective leans towards BLUETTI.
